Latest Patents
Among his latest patents, Fenstermaker has developed a method and apparatus for the treatment of hydrocarbons. This innovative process involves the separation of a caustic-treated hydrocarbon feed mixture into two streams. The first stream is treated with an adsorbent material, resulting in a reactor feed stream that significantly reduces the concentration of contaminating water and sulfur compounds. This treated stream is then combined with hydrogen under optimal isomerization conditions in the presence of an isomerization catalyst, ultimately producing an isomerate product.
